I've watched all their videos about it several times. I don't know if you just can't tell from the photo, but in the fork lock position it makes full contact and appears to stop before hitting 100%. A piece of paper is trapped between the radio and ignition switch and rips getting pulled out. This is NOT how they advertise their installs.
Loosen up the 4 bolts (2 on each side) that bolts the inner fairing to the triple tree.
Get someone to help you by pushing forward on the top of the inner fairing. This will push back the entire fairing assembly. Keep the pressure on the fairing while you tighten up the bolts. This should give you a little more room between the radio and the ignition switch.

I had already pushed the fairing back. I am supposed to be getting it dropped off this morning from the dealership. They had not pushed the radio as far back as it can go. The service manager confirmed it now has a 1/8 inch gap with the switch turned all the way, and that all ignition switch functions now work properly.

He said he's sure it was due to limited travel. So now the switch does not make contact with the radio and it's not misaligned. I'll be confirming after they drop it off.
